Fagan to lead Aerion interior design
The Mach 1.4 AS2 business jet should begin flight testing in 2024. It will have a GE Affinity supersonic engine and development is supported by Boeing. The interior is in the hands of newly appointed designer Tim Fagan.
From B-2 stealth bomber engineer to president of Northrop Grumman aerospace systems, Aerion leader Tom Vice serves on the board of, among others, the Smithsonian National Air and Space Museum.

Supersonic aircraft developer Aerion has appointed Tim Fagan as chief of industrial design. He will lead the team for the interior design of the AS2 supersonic business jet.

Fagan is an expert in aviation industrial design and an innovator in aircraft interior development; passionate about aviation and creating exceptional in-flight passenger experiences. He brings extensive experience in product development, with projects that include leading the industrial design of the Bombardier Global 7500 interior, and the Bombardier Global 5000 and Global 6000 Premier Cabin. He also led industrial design activity for the Bombardier Vision Flight Deck, the Bombardier Dash 8 Q400 interior and the 2010 Olympic Torch, and has held positions in customer-facing roles in business jet completion.
